Mikel Arteta delivers Bruno Guimaraes fitness update ahead of Aston Villa clash
Arsenal have been handed a timely boost with Bruno Guimaraes back in training and potentially available for Monday’s trip to Aston Villa.
Arsenal have received encouraging news on Bruno Guimaraes ahead of Monday’s Premier League meeting with Aston Villa, with Mikel Arteta confirming the midfielder has returned to training after missing the opening-day victory over Coventry City.
The Brazil international picked up a groin problem during the Community Shield win over Manchester City, forcing Arsenal to manage his workload carefully. Arteta said Guimaraes has been working on the pitch and could be available for selection at Villa Park if he continues to respond positively.
The update provides a boost for the Premier League champions, who began their title defence with a convincing 3-0 victory over Coventry City.
Guimaraes, signed from Newcastle in a major summer move, made an immediate impression during his Arsenal debut and is expected to strengthen Arteta’s midfield once fully fit.
Arsenal also have positive defensive news, with Ezri Konsa available to face his former club after completing his move from Aston Villa and training with his new teammates.
However, Arteta will remain without William Saliba and Jurrien Timber, who are still recovering from longer-term problems.
Dutch defender Timber has made progress in his rehabilitation and is expected to increase his workload next week if his recovery continues without complications.
The contrast in the injury situations leaves Arteta hopeful of strengthening his midfield options while still having to manage his defensive resources carefully.
Arsenal will travel to Villa Park looking to maintain the momentum generated by their emphatic opening-weekend performance, while Guimaraes will face a late fitness assessment before the squad is confirmed.
